Top 10 Christian YouTube Songs February 20-26, 2026: Official Chart

The worship music scene is buzzing this week. For the period of February 20-26, 2026, our official chart, based on YouTube streaming data, recorded over 5.4 million views. It's the track "Alleluia" by Elevation Worship and Chandler Moore that seizes the top spot, dethroning the powerhouse of Bethel Music to second position.

This week is marked by an impressive influx of 13 new entries into the top 50, a strong indicator of the genre's dynamism. We also observe a general downward trend, with 37 tracks dropping compared to only 3 rising, signaling an intense refresh of gospel music listeners' playlists.

A Fresh Wave with Powerful Newcomers

Among the new arrivals, Nigerian star Mercy Chinwo makes a striking debut at #7 with "My Lover (Live)," confirming her international status. The collective Maverick City continues to expand its influence, notably through its ongoing collaboration with Naomi Raine, which remains well-charted. The diversity of styles, ranging from the power of Hillsong Worship to the energy of Ada Ehi with her track "Congratulations," demonstrates the richness and constant evolution of contemporary gospel.

This new top 10, while dominated by established artists, hints at the emergence of new talent. The popular song "God Will Work It Out" by Naomi Raine, propelled by Maverick City, is a perfect example of these attention-grabbing collaborations. While confirmed artists like Brandon Lake (with CeCe Winans) or Casting Crowns ("Who Am I") maintain a solid presence, the progression of tracks like "In Christ Alone" by Jenn Johnson shows that revisited classics still find favor with the audience.

Another major takeaway from this session is the performance of African artists. Beyond Mercy Chinwo and Ada Ehi, we note the breakthrough of Moses Bliss in collaboration with Chandler Moore ("Your Love"), entering at #24. This vitality underscores the growing importance of the Nigerian and South African scenes in the global landscape of Christian music 2026, offering a striking contrast to the more polished style of American megachurches.
